Observations
All 72 projects are live and active. Every project in May 2026 has recorded at least one message, indicating these are working tools rather than abandoned drafts. This is a sign of disciplined project creation — users create projects with intent and use them.
Projects are primarily personal workspaces. Only 3 of 72 projects (4%) show multi-user activity, suggesting that the Projects feature is being used mainly for individual context-setting and organised prompt history rather than collaboration. This is not a problem — it is the dominant use pattern for ChatGPT Projects broadly — but it represents a missed opportunity for team knowledge sharing.
One project dominates volume. "Særvices" by mara@omada.net accounts for 280 of 1,229 total project messages (22.8%), indicating a single power user is driving a significant share of project-level activity. This is not a governance concern, but the concentration is worth noting.

Governance Recommendations
Projects feature is being used well. All active projects have usage. No cleanup of dormant projects is needed this month. Continue monitoring monthly to catch projects that go stale over time.
Encourage team projects for collaborative work. The ICP & Targeting Lab and IGA Benchmark projects show that multi-user collaboration is possible. Identify 2–3 teams where a shared project context (e.g. RFP response, competitive analysis, customer onboarding) would add value and run a pilot.
Establish a project naming and tagging convention. Project names like "Særvices," "P&B," and "Cadmus" are opaque to anyone other than the creator. A lightweight naming standard (e.g. [Team/Purpose/Date]) would help if shared projects become more common and governance reviews are introduced.
